To tackle the question, I’ll lay out the core concepts about a resting membrane potential and then evaluate each statement.
Option 1: 'The membrane is more permeable to potassium than sodium.' At rest, the neuronal membrane is indeed more permeable to K+ than to Na+, largely due to potassium leak channels. This differential permeability is a key contributor to the negative resting membrane potential.
